The building thermal insulation market in Australia is expanding as building owners and developers prioritize energy efficiency and compliance with building codes. Thermal insulation materials such as foam boards, fiberglass, and reflective coatings help reduce heat transfer, improve indoor comfort, and lower energy consumption for heating and cooling. With increasing focus on sustainability and green building practices, the market for thermal insulation is expected to grow, driven by residential, commercial, and industrial construction projects.
The Australia building thermal insulation market is witnessing significant growth due to several key drivers. Firstly, there`s a growing awareness of energy efficiency and the need to reduce carbon emissions in the construction sector. Thermal insulation materials help improve building envelope performance, reducing heat transfer and energy consumption for heating and cooling. Secondly, government regulations and incentives promoting energy-efficient building practices are driving demand for thermal insulation solutions. Additionally, the increasing focus on occupant comfort and indoor air quality is spurring demand for insulation materials that also provide acoustic insulation properties. Furthermore, advancements in insulation materials technology, including innovative products with higher thermal resistance and sustainable attributes, are further fueling market growth.
Challenges in the Australia building thermal insulation market include material sustainability and thermal performance. Adapting to changes in energy efficiency regulations and addressing concerns regarding insulation installation are ongoing challenges for manufacturers.
The building thermal insulation market in Australia involves the installation of materials to reduce heat transfer and improve energy efficiency in buildings. These materials include insulation batts, foams, reflective coatings, and aerogels. Government regulations mandate minimum insulation requirements for new construction and renovations to meet energy efficiency standards. Market dynamics are influenced by factors such as climate conditions, energy prices, building codes, and advancements in insulation technology promoting sustainability and thermal performance.
